Plenty of hunters on here not too far from Wheelock. If you would like I can get you in contact with a few that will get you the opportunity to see different styles of hunting. One of them ties every hog, and sells them to a couple of game ranches outside Centerville.
I agree that starting off with pups is an uphill battle. Sure people have pulled it off, but they are rare. Go hunt with as many different people as possible, then decide what type of dog you like. Loose, rough, open, silent, etc. I know that the type of dogs I wanted when I started out are vastly different than the dogs I am currently running. Caught hogs with both, just prefer what I have now.
